Deep brain stimulation (DBS) has been established as an effective neuromodulatory treatment for Parkinson's disease (PD) with motor complications or refractory tremor. Various DBS devices unique technology platforms are commercially available and deliver continuous, open-loop stimulation. The Percept™ family of neurostimulators use BrainSense™ five key features to sense local field potentials while stimulating, enabling integration physiologic data into the routine practice programming. newly approved rechargeable RC implantable pulse generator offers a smaller, thinner design reduced recharge time prolonged interval. In this review, we describe application potential sensing-based programming in PD highlight future clinical implementation closed-loop using generator.
